West  Port-   ( Est 2004)  are an up and coming multi- talented versatile band of 4/5 musicians from the Leeds-Huddersfield area.We  play sets of lively Irish  and Scottish tunes - some with sensitive arrangements - and also  for our Folk club and concert   appearances do songs from traditional & Original sources with an emphasis on popular established chorus songs.Alternatively we can do a full night of popular Irish  pub songs if that is required.

     As  Barry Smith and   The Westport Tinkers  we did our first folk club booking at the Topic , A bbey Road, Bradford- which was well received in 2004.

Several featured folk club  spots and charity concerts followed as we consolidated and got the act together for The Otley.-Folk Festival in 2004 and the band developed and played at festivals, folk clubs, private functions,etc. throughout 2005

 

IN 2006  WEST PORT played  in concert at 5 festivals.

Following our performance in the main Fri. night concert at The Otley Festival M.C.  Robin Garside quoted:

 

"WEST PORT PLAY FINE OLD MUSIC IN FINE STYLE"

*******THE GROVE, LEEDS 14 OCT  2004

An epic night where we played to a large enthusiastic audience.The gig earned us an excellent review on  The Leeds Music SceneWebsite.

Here John Hepworth wrote" The programme for the gig was as might be expected in terms of opening with a set oj jigs and interspersing tradsongs and tunes with some self-penned material.The presentation showed how these players combine in a sound that is absorbing to the point of being at times hypnotic as they quickly came to a good lively session feel that filled the room with tasty cross-rhythms. REVIEWS

       TOPIC OF CONVERSATION-(17 01 06)

Paul Abraham on the Leeds Acoustic musicwebsite-www.keepmusiclive.blogspot.com posted a review of our Topic gig.

" In a packed room and with an atmosphere of great anticipation it was announced that West port would play.This was a night to remember.When the ever versatile Barry Smith sang ' Couldn't have come at a better time" we couldn,t have put it better ourselves.This was an evening of pure class".

      ANOTHER  REVIEW.

 John Waller from The Topic forwarded this email from a member of the audience who had come primarily to see the support act Scarlett Heights.

"What a a nice surprise- I got a Pipe Major and some well thought out tune arrangements. If I was Barry, I,d be proud of putting that bunch together, they were excellent.
